Old Fashioned Apple Pie

Prep Time: 20 mins

Cook Time: 50 mins

Total Time: 1 hrs 10 mins

Servings: 8

Yield: 1 9-inch pie

Rating: 4.6

Ingredients

2 (9 inch) unbaked pie crusts, 7 cups peeled, cored and sliced apples, 1 cup white sugar, 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our, 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on, ¼ teaspoon salt, ⅛ teaspoon ground nutmeg, 2 tablespoons butter

Instructions

Begin by preheating your o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C) and placing the bottom crust into a 9-inch pie plate. In a separate bowl, stir together the apples, sugar, flour, cinnamon, salt, and nutmeg, then spread this mixture into the pie plate. Place bits of butter over the filling, cover with the top crust, and seal the edges tightly. Slit the top crust to vent steam. Bake for 10 minutes, then lower the temperature to 300 degrees F (150 degrees C) and bake for another 40 to 50 minutes until the apples are soft and the crust is golden. Let the pie cool before serving.
